Interesting facts
1

The tower was originally part of a double-gate system known as the 'Castle Gate'.

2

It is one of only two remaining watchtowers from the city's original 14th-century defensive perimeter.

3

During the 19th century, the surrounding city walls were largely demolished to allow for urban expansion, leaving the tower as a detached monument.

4

The masonry consists primarily of local stone and brickwork consistent with regional Silesian architecture.

5

The tower was subject to major conservation work in the early 2000s to stabilize the structure for public access.

Overview

Wieża Bramy Zamkowej is a historic defensive tower and one of the few surviving elements of the medieval fortifications that once enclosed Jelenia Góra. Constructed in the 16th century, the tower served as part of the town's defensive gate system, which protected the main access point from the west. The structure features a cylindrical shape and was integrated into the city wall perimeter near the former castle gate. Today, the tower is preserved as a regional heritage site and serves as a vantage point for the surrounding Karkonosze Mountains. Visitors can ascend to the upper observation level via an internal staircase. The site provides context regarding the town's transition from a fortified stronghold to a mercantile center.
